Nintendo Co., Ltd. will host a Japanese Nintendo Direct at 11 p.m. ET/8 p.m. PT. Nintendo of America will follow it up with a video Nintendo Direct afterwards.
UPDATE 6:30 p.m. PT - The Nintendo Direct will be focused on 3DS games, likely Paper Mario: Sticker Star.
We have no idea what the content of this Nintendo Direct will be, but it could be some combination of Wii U and 3DS games in early 2013, or possibly highlighting upcoming 2012 releases.
Wii U-focused Nintendo Directs were held in Europe and Japan on September 13, while North America had a live event in New York City. There was a Nintendo Direct in Japan at the end of August that focused on upcoming 3DS games.
